Md. Code, State Finance and Procurement § 7-304

This is the official text of Md. Code, State Finance and Procurement § 7-304, part of Maryland’s Code, State Finance and Procurement — governs the state budget and government contracting.

§7–304.

Official statutory text

At the end of a fiscal year, the unspent part of an appropriation from a source that State law or an Act of Congress dedicates to a specific purpose does not revert to the General Fund of the State but reverts to the appropriate special fund.
